Custom connector doesn't prompt reauth when OAuth token expires — silently loses tool access

When a custom MCP connector's OAuth access token expires, the server correctly returns `401` with a `WWW-Authenticate` header pointing to `/.well-known/oauth-protected-resource` (per the MCP auth spec). Claude doesn't act on this signal — the tool silently disappears from the conversation with no reauth prompt and no visible error explaining why. The only fix is manually going to Settings → Connectors and disconnecting/reconnecting the connector.
Expected: Claude should either automatically redo the OAuth flow using the discovered protected-resource metadata, or at minimum surface a "this connector needs reauthorization" prompt to the user instead of failing silently.
This matches a known limitation referenced in third-party MCP server docs ("some clients including the Claude app and Claude Code do not yet auto re-initialize on a 404 and require a manual reconnect").
